- What does Aspire Firestone Academy Charter District spend the most on?
- Based on 24 tracked contracts, Aspire Firestone Academy Charter District spends most on Recreation & Community Services (7), Budget Planning (5), Community & Outreach (5), Public Updates (4), and Capital Projects (3). Contract types include FINANCIAL_SERVICES, FACILITIES, PROFESSIONAL_SERVICES, CONSTRUCTION, and LEGAL. - Who are Aspire Firestone Academy Charter District's current vendors?
- Aspire Firestone Academy Charter District currently works with vendors including UMPQUA, DIOCESE, JOFFE EMERGENCY SERVICES, COLUMBIA BANK (FORMERLY UMPQUA), ASPIRE COLLEGE ACADEMY, ASPIRE TRIUMPH ACADEMY, COLUMBIA BANK, and NIXON PEABODY LLP. These vendors span contract types like FINANCIAL_SERVICES, FACILITIES, PROFESSIONAL_SERVICES, CONSTRUCTION, and LEGAL.
